| I'm using the Small Business edition, and am toying with the idea of entering invoices to track receivables. My question is on the Cash Flow Forecast graph - it currently shows the income as of the invoice date. Most customers are net 15 or net 30, and I would prefer to see the income in the graph based on the expected receipt date. Any way to change this? Bob M.. |
